Shadcn.io is not affiliated with official shadcn/ui
Storefront Order History
Order history with expandable rows, status filters, and reorder actions built with React, Next.js, shadcn/ui Button, and Tailwind CSS
Let customers easily track and revisit past purchases with this order history block. Each order is displayed as an expandable row showing order number, date, total, item count, and a colored status dot for Delivered, Shipped, or Processing states. Expanding a row reveals the individual items with thumbnails, names, and prices. Uses shadcn/ui Button component. Perfect for customer dashboards, account pages, order management portals.
Related Components
Checkout
Checkout form
Recently Viewed
Recently viewed products
Quick View
Product quick view modal
Waitlist
Product waitlist signup
Loyalty
Rewards program
Product Showcase
Tabbed product display
FAQ
Was this page helpful?
Sign in to leave feedback.
Order Cancellation
Multi-step order cancellation with reason selection, refund estimate, and confirmation using React, Next.js, shadcn/ui Button, and Tailwind CSS
Order Invoice
Downloadable invoice with line items, tax breakdown, and billing addresses using React, Next.js, shadcn/ui Button, and Tailwind CSS